HR8005 is a double giant star in the constellation of Cygnus.

HR8005 visual magnitude is 5.47. Because of its reltive faintness, HR8005 should be visible only from locations with dark skies, while it is not visible at all from skies affected by light pollution.

The proper motion of HR8005 is -0.021 arcsec per year in Right Ascension and 0.038 arcsec per year in Declination and the associated displacement for the next 10000 years is represented with the red arrow.

Distance of HR8005 from the Sun and relative movement

HR8005 is distant 609.35 light years from the Sun and it is moving towards the Sun at the speed of 10 kilometers per second.
